Now you can fill the Title: box and search for subtitles by name, or by hash. If you want to search subtitles go the VLC upper menu → Extensions → and click on VLsub option. How does VLSub work in VLC Media Player for Mac? ![]() Right click on VLC app and select Show Package Contents from menu.Ĭontents/MacOS/share/lua/ → create folder called extensions → open it and paste a file here. If you want to install VLSub for all users of your Mac, copy a file to clipboard → open Finder → Applications folder. Users/%your_name%/Library/Application Support//lua/extensions/Īnd paste the a file to this folder. If you want to install VLSub for only current user on your Mac open Finder, or other file manager and go to the: ![]() Open the archive and copy the a file to clipboard ( CMD+C shortcut). There are two ways how to install VLSub plug-in to VLC Media Player for Mac.Īt first download the. How to install VLSub plug-in to VLC Media Player for Mac ![]() These applications dominate industry and research for the development of various smart-world systems. Traditionally, the consciousness of a certain patient can be determined based on his eye opening, verbal and motor responses which are the factors of GCS. Level of consciousness can be obtained by evaluation of Glasgow coma scale (GCS) using several methods such as electroencephalography (EEG) and vital signs. ![]() ![]() For this reason, the care givers should rapidly handle the patients in this case to survive them.
